Pharmacy Technician Jobs in Texas
A Pharmacy Technician is a frontline figure in the pharmacy industry, responsible for a variety of tasks to assist the pharmacist and ensure the efficient operation of the pharmacy. They are often involved in receiving and verifying prescriptions, preparing and dispensing medications, maintaining patient records, and performing inventory checks. Additionally, Pharmacy Technicians must be capable of providing excellent customer service as they frequently interact with patients, answering their questions and providing information about their prescriptions. They also liaise with healthcare providers and insurance companies to manage and resolve any issues related to prescriptions.
Although specific requirements can vary by state, most Pharmacy Technicians should have a high school diploma or equivalent, and many employers prefer candidates who have completed a post-secondary education program in pharmacy technology. They must also possess certain important skills, such as att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and the ability to multitask. Many states require Pharmacy Technicians to be certified, which generally involves passing an exam, such as the Pharmacy Technician Certification Exam (PTCE) or the Exam for the Certification of Pharmacy Technicians (ExCPT). Before becoming a Pharmacy Technician, individuals may have held roles such as a pharmacy clerk, customer service associate, or medical assistant, thus gaining valuable experience in the healthcare industry.
